BTCL shares jump 30% on debut

Botswana Telecommunications Corporation Limited (BTCL) shares surged 30 percent to P1.30 on its first day of trading on the Botswana Stock Exchange on Friday.

The company listed 1.05 billion shares on the bourse marking the completion of the country’s first privatisation of a state-owned enterprise.

The shares listed at one pula per share but moved up to P1.30 on its debut after 31,000 shares changed hands in two transactions resulting in a turnover of P40,300.
